Met Éireann has extended a weather advisory until 7pm on Wednesday with heavy showers forecast for much of the country over the coming days.

There will be further spells of heavy rain or showers, possibly causing disruption.

The advisory, which is a level below a yellow weather warning, is for all counties in the Republic.

But there is also some sunshine on the way for much of the country in the second half of the week.

Good spells of warm sunshine are forecast on Thursday along with scattered showers. These showers will be heavy in places with a possibility of thunder.

Maximum temperatures will be 17 to 20 degrees in light to moderate northerly breezes.

Friday looks set to be another bright day with temperatures in the high teens and early 20s.

Met Éireann says that indications suggest the weekend will bring plenty of dry weather with just a few showers.
